The United States is home to some of the world’s most prestigious universities, offering cutting-edge computer science programmes that combine academic rigour with real-world innovation. With a strong emphasis on research, technology, and interdisciplinary learning, American colleges prepare students to lead in fields such as artificial intelligence, cybersecurity, and software engineering.

Studying in the USA also means direct access to global tech hubs like Silicon Valley, where students can network with industry leaders, attend major conferences, and gain hands-on experience through internships at top-tier companies. These opportunities not only enrich your education but also give you a competitive edge in the global job market.

Explore how a degree in Computer Science in the USA can shape your future, and start your journey today with a free consultation from StudyIn.


Five Reasons to Study Computer Science in the United States

1. Globally Recognised Degrees

US universities offer computer science qualifications that are respected worldwide. Graduates benefit from strong academic reputations, rigorous training, and transferable skills that open doors to careers and further study across global markets.

Search Computer Science courses

2. Access to Cutting-Edge Research

The USA leads in technological innovation, with major investments in artificial intelligence, cybersecurity, robotics, and data science. Students gain hands-on experience through research projects, labs, and collaborations with leading tech companies and government agencies.

3. Career Opportunities and OPT Extension

Computer science graduates are in high demand across industries. International students can benefit from the STEM OPT extension, allowing up to three years of post-study work in the US—ideal for gaining experience and launching a global career.

4. Proximity to Global Tech Hubs

Studying in the US places students near major innovation centres such as Silicon Valley, Seattle, Boston, and Austin. These regions offer internships, networking events, and exposure to industry leaders, enhancing employability and professional growth.

5. Diverse and Inclusive Learning Environment

US universities foster multicultural communities where students collaborate across cultures and disciplines. Computer science programmes encourage teamwork, creativity, and problem-solving—skills essential for success in today’s interconnected digital world.


10 Great US Universities for Computer Science

Johns Hopkins University

Johns Hopkins is a world-renowned research university known for its pioneering work in data science, artificial intelligence, and biomedical computing. Its computer science programme blends rigorous theory with real-world applications, supported by cutting-edge labs and interdisciplinary collaboration across engineering, medicine, and public health.

  • Suggested course: BS in Computer Science
  • Entry requirements: Competitive GPA (3.9+), SAT/ACT optional, strong maths background
  • Location: Baltimore, Maryland

Rutgers University – New Brunswick

Rutgers’ School of Arts and Sciences offers a robust computer science programme with strengths in algorithms, machine learning, and cybersecurity. As a flagship public research university, it provides access to industry partnerships, research centres, and a vibrant tech ecosystem in the New York–New Jersey corridor.

  • Suggested course: BS in Computer Science
  • Entry requirements: GPA 3.5+, SAT/ACT optional, strong STEM preparation
  • Location: New Brunswick, New Jersey

Tulane University

Tulane’s computer science programme is growing rapidly, with a focus on interdisciplinary applications in health, environment, and social impact. Students benefit from small class sizes, research opportunities, and access to New Orleans’ emerging tech scene. The curriculum balances theory, software development, and data science.

  • Suggested course: BS in Computer Science
  • Entry requirements: GPA 3.6+, SAT/ACT optional, strong academic record
  • Location: New Orleans, Louisiana

University at Buffalo (SUNY)

UB’s Department of Computer Science and Engineering is one of the largest in the SUNY system, offering strong programmes in AI, robotics, and software systems. Students benefit from research-driven teaching, industry partnerships, and access to New York’s growing tech sector.

  • Suggested course: BS in Computer Science
  • Entry requirements: GPA 3.5+, SAT/ACT optional, maths and science prerequisites
  • Location: Buffalo, New York

University of Arizona

Arizona’s computer science programme is highly ranked for its research in cybersecurity, software engineering, and computational theory. Students enjoy access to advanced labs, internships, and interdisciplinary projects, especially in health and space sciences. The university’s Tucson campus offers a vibrant student experience.

  • Suggested course: BS in Computer Science
  • Entry requirements: GPA 3.4+, SAT/ACT optional, maths readiness required
  • Location: Tucson, Arizona

University of California, Irvine

UC Irvine’s Donald Bren School of Information and Computer Sciences is globally respected for its strengths in machine learning, human-computer interaction, and software engineering. Located in Southern California’s tech hub, students benefit from strong industry ties and research-led teaching.

  • Suggested course: BS in Computer Science
  • Entry requirements: GPA 4.0+, UC A–G subject completion, SAT/ACT optional
  • Location: Irvine, California

University of Kansas

KU’s computer science programme offers a solid foundation in programming, systems, and data structures, with growing strengths in AI and cybersecurity. Students benefit from hands-on labs, research opportunities, and a supportive academic environment in a classic Midwestern campus setting.

  • Suggested course: BS in Computer Science
  • Entry requirements: GPA 3.25+, ACT 21+ or SAT 1060+, maths prerequisites
  • Location: Lawrence, Kansas

University of South Carolina

USC’s computer science programme is known for its applied focus, with strengths in software engineering, data analytics, and cybersecurity. Students benefit from research centres, industry partnerships, and a strong co-op and internship culture in the Southeast tech corridor.

  • Suggested course: BS in Computer Science
  • Entry requirements: GPA 3.5+, SAT/ACT optional, strong maths background
  • Location: Columbia, South Carolina

University of Texas at San Antonio (UTSA)

UTSA is a rising star in computer science, especially in cybersecurity and cloud computing. As a designated National Center of Academic Excellence in Cyber Defense, it offers strong industry links, research funding, and career pathways in Texas’ booming tech sector.

  • Suggested course: BS in Computer Science
  • Entry requirements: GPA 3.0+, SAT/ACT optional, maths readiness required
  • Location: San Antonio, Texas

University of Utah

The University of Utah is a leader in computer graphics, HCI, and computing theory. Its School of Computing is known for innovation and entrepreneurship, with strong ties to Silicon Slopes and the broader tech industry. Students benefit from research labs and startup incubators.

  • Suggested course: BS in Computer Science
  • Entry requirements: GPA 3.6+, SAT/ACT optional, strong STEM coursework
  • Location: Salt Lake City, Utah

Cost of Studying Computer Science in the USA

The total cost of studying computer science in the United States varies widely based on the type of institution (public or private), degree level, and city. Here’s a breakdown for international students in 2025:

Tuition fees (per year)

  • Public universities: $20,000–$40,000
  • Private universities: $40,000–$60,000
  • Top-tier institutions (e.g. Johns Hopkins, UC Irvine): $50,000+

Living expenses (per year)

  • Average range: $10,000–$20,000 (Includes housing, food, transport, health insurance, and personal costs)

Additional costs

  • Student visa (F-1): ~$510
  • Textbooks and supplies: $1,000–$2,000
  • Travel and personal expenses: Varies by location

Many universities offer scholarships, graduate assistantships, or on-campus jobs to help offset costs. Public universities tend to be more affordable, especially for undergraduate programmes, while private institutions may offer more generous financial aid packages.


Career Prospects for Computer Science Graduates

Computer science graduates from US universities are highly sought after across global industries, including technology, finance, healthcare, defence, and manufacturing. With a strong emphasis on practical skills, innovation, and interdisciplinary learning, US-trained professionals are well-equipped to tackle complex challenges and lead digital transformation.

International students benefit from the STEM OPT extension, which allows them to work in the United States for up to three years after graduation. This extended post-study work period provides valuable industry experience and can serve as a stepping stone to long-term employment or further academic study.

Graduates often secure roles in software development, data science, cybersecurity, artificial intelligence, and systems architecture. Many go on to work for leading companies such as Google, Microsoft, Amazon, Meta, and IBM, or join startups and research labs. With a US computer science degree, students gain not only technical expertise but also the adaptability and global perspective that employers value.


Study Computer Science in the USA

If you want to learn more about studying a computer science degree in the USA, arrange a free consultation with StudyIn today.


FAQs

Can I study computer science in the USA as an international student?

Yes. The United States welcomes international students to study computer science at undergraduate and postgraduate levels. You’ll need to meet academic entry requirements, demonstrate English proficiency (TOEFL or IELTS), and obtain an F-1 student visa. Many universities offer support services and scholarships for international applicants.

How much does it cost to study computer science in the USA?

The total annual cost typically ranges from $30,000 to $60,000, depending on the university and location. This includes tuition fees (usually $20,000–$50,000) and living expenses (around $10,000–$20,000). Public universities tend to be more affordable, while private institutions may offer more financial aid.

Which state in the USA is best for studying computer science?

California is widely considered the best state for computer science due to its proximity to Silicon Valley and major tech employers. Massachusetts (home to MIT and Harvard) and Washington (home to Microsoft and Amazon) also offer excellent programmes, strong industry links, and career opportunities.

Which university is best in the USA for computer science?

Top-ranked universities for computer science in 2025 include:

  • Massachusetts Institute of Technology (MIT) – #1 globally for CS
  • Stanford University – Renowned for AI, software engineering, and entrepreneurship
  • Carnegie Mellon University – Leading in robotics, cybersecurity, and systems
  • University of California, Berkeley – Strong in data science, theory, and innovation

These institutions offer cutting-edge research, global recognition, and strong graduate outcomes.

What are the career prospects after studying computer science in the USA?

Graduates are in high demand across industries such as software development, AI, cybersecurity, and data science. International students can work in the US for up to three years after graduation under the STEM OPT extension, gaining valuable experience and boosting global employability.